Table LII. Field 5 Register Map
Data Bit Default
Address Content Value Register Name Description
F8 [3:0] 0 VSEQSEL0_5 Selected V-Sequence for Region 0.
[4] 0 SWEEP0_5 Select Sweep Region for Region 0. 0 = No Sweep, 1 = Sweep.
[5] 0 MULTI0_5 Select Multiplier Region for Region 0. 0 = No Multiplier, 1 = Multiplier.
[9:6] 0 VSEQSEL1_5 Selected V-Sequence for Region 1.
[10] 0 SWEEP1_5 Select Sweep Region for Region 1. 0 = No Sweep, 1 = Sweep.
[11] 0 MULTI1_5 Select Multiplier Region for Region 1. 0 = No Multiplier, 1 = Multiplier.
[15:12] 0 VSEQSEL2_5 Selected V-Sequence for Region 2.
[16] 0 SWEEP2_5 Select Sweep Region for Region 2. 0 = No Sweep, 1 = Sweep.
[17] 0 MULTI2_5 Select Multiplier Region for Region 2. 0 = No Multiplier, 1 = Multiplier.
[21:18] 0 VSEQSEL3_5 Selected V-Sequence for Region 3.
[22] 0 SWEEP3_5 Select Sweep Region for Region 3. 0 = No Sweep, 1 = Sweep.
[23] 0 MULTI3_5 Select Multiplier Region for Region 3. 0 = No Multiplier, 1 = Multiplier.
F9 [3:0] 0 VSEQSEL4_5 Selected V-Sequence for Region 4.
[4] 0 SWEEP4_5 Select Sweep Region for Region 4. 0 = No Sweep, 1 = Sweep
[5] 0 MULTI4_5 Select Multiplier Region for Region 4. 0 = No Multiplier, 1 = Multiplier.
[9:6] 0 VSEQSEL5_5 Selected V-Sequence for Region 5.
[10] 0 SWEEP5_5 Select Sweep Region for Region 5. 0 = No Sweep, 1 = Sweep.
[11] 0 MULTI5_5 Select Multiplier Region for Region 5. 0 =No Multiplier, 1 = Multiplier.
[15:12] 0 VSEQSEL6_5 Selected V-Sequence for Region 6.
[16] 0 SWEEP6_5 Select Sweep Region for Region 6. 0 = No Sweep, 1 = Sweep.
[17] 0 MULTI6_5 Select Multiplier Region for Region 6. 0 = No Multiplier, 1 = Multiplier.
[23:18] UNUSED Unused.
FA [11:0] 0 SCP1_5 V-Sequence Change Position #1 for Field 5.
[23:12] 0 SCP2_5 V-Sequence Change Position #2 for Field 5.
FB [11:0] 0 SCP3_5 V-Sequence Change Position #3 for Field 5.
[23:12] 0 SCP4_5 V-Sequence Change Position #4 for Field 5.
FC [11:0] 0 VDLEN_5 VD Field Length (Number of Lines) for Field 5.
[23:12] 0 HDLAST_5 HD Line Length (Number of Pixels) for Last Line in Field 5.
FD [3:0] 0 VPATSECOND_5 Selected Second V-Pattern Group for VSG Active Line.
[9:4] 0 SGMASK_5 Masking of VSG Outputs during VSG Active Line.
[21:10] 0 SGPATSEL_5 Selection of VSG Patterns for Each VSG Output.
FE [11:0] 0 SGLINE1_5 VSG Active Line 1.
[23:12] 0 SGLINE2_5 VSG Active Line 2 (if no Second Line Needed, Set to Same as Line 1 or Max).
FF [11:0] 0 SCP5_5 V-Sequence Change Position #5 for Field 5.
[23:12] 0 SCP6_5 V-Sequence Change Position #6 for Field 5.
